Illéskéd
Illéskéd is a locality within the Szabolcs-Szatmár-Bereg county of Hungary. It is situated in the northern part of the county, near the Romanian border. Administratively, Illéskéd is part of the municipality of Vaja. The area is characterized by its rural landscape, typical of the northeastern Hungarian plains.
